Emergency Department
Our Emergency
Department, located on the ground floor of the hospital, treats
children requiring immediate medical attention 24 hours-a-day, seven
days-a-week. We see all patients as quickly as possible. As a Level 1
Trauma Center, we provide comprehensive care during medical or
trauma-related emergencies to more than 70,000 children and adolescents
each year.
Emergency Department Exam Room
The 17,300-square-foot center contains 36 examination and resuscitation
rooms. Board-certified pediatric emergency medicine physicians are in
attendance at all times, and pediatric and surgical subspecialty care
is available as needed.
Neonatal Intensive Care Unit (NICU)
Our Level
IIIC Neonatal Intensive Care Unit (NICU) is a 30-bed
full-service facility that offers individualized care for the complex
needs of each infant. All of our staff members are experts in newborn
intensive care and deliver highly-specialized around the clock care.

Sleep Center
Our Sleep
Center is accredited by the American Academy of Sleep Medicine
and provides overnight sleep testing for children with a variety of
sleep disorders.
Child Life Playrooms
Children enjoy visiting our playrooms during designated hours to
participate in a wide array of fun activities. In addition to offering
creative and therapeutic activities for inpatient children, Child Life
Specialists actively help patients and families prepare for surgery and
procedures. Specialists are available to meet with families of both
medical and surgical patients, conduct hospital tours, and explain the
upcoming procedures using dolls and simple terms children can
understand.

Medical-Surgical Nursing Station
Experienced pediatric nurses staff our fourth and fifth floor
medical-surgical units. If your child is hospitalized overnight at St.
Chris, one parent can stay with the child in his or her room. Every
patient room is equipped with fold-out cots, and there are additional
facilities at the Ronald
McDonald House on campus for qualifying families.
